Ibrahima Konate's contract with Liverpool expires at the end of the season, leaving him able to depart on a free transfer in six weeks. Liverpool have submitted a final contract proposal and consider it their last offer after prolonged negotiations. Konate has been linked with top European clubs, notably Real Madrid, and reportedly has maintained contact with them. Acceptance of Liverpool's terms would make Konate one of the club's highest-paid players and reflect manager Arne Slot's confidence in him. Konate has underperformed this season but remains highly regarded when at peak form. Liverpool face a choice about matching his ambitions to avoid losing him for free.
